Artist: Lee Krasner (American, 1908-1984)
American female abstract painter and collage artist during the heydays of abstract expressionism. Krasner completed her studies in National Academy of Design and was involved in mural works of Works Progress Administration's Public Works of Art Project (WPA) as well as American Abstract Artists. Many of her works such as her series, Little Image, were inspired by Henri Matisse and Piet Mondrian. Krasner is known for working with multi-media collage after her marriage with Jackson Pollock. Her work was often shadowed by her husband's work.
